Engine ventilation scheme
A and B - operation of the carburetor spool device at a low crankshaft speed (A) and at high (IN);
1 - drain pipe of the oil separator; 2 - oil separator; 3 - breather cover; 4 – gas suction hose; 5 - flame arrester; 6 - exhaust manifold; 7 - filter element of the air filter; 8 - a hose for venting gases into the throttle space of the carburetor; 9 - axis of the throttle valve of the primary chamber; 10 - spool; 11 - spool groove; 12 - calibrated hole
For flushing, disconnect the ventilation hoses 4 and 8 from the nozzles, remove the flame arrester 5 from the hose 4, remove the breather cover 3 and wash them with gasoline or kerosene.
It is also necessary to flush the spool device of the carburetor, the cavities and nozzles of the air filter through which the exhausted gases pass.
